5 Types of Plant Explosion Cases We Handle
1. Chemical Plant Explosions
Industrial accidents at chemical manufacturing facilities involving toxic releases, vapor cloud explosions, and runaway chemical reactions that cause severe burns, respiratory injuries, and toxic exposure to workers and nearby residents.
2. Oil Refinery Explosions
Catastrophic failures at petroleum refineries resulting from equipment malfunctions, maintenance negligence, or safety violations that cause massive fires, explosions, and environmental contamination affecting entire communities.
3. Petrochemical Facility Explosions
Accidents at facilities processing petroleum products and chemicals, including pipeline ruptures, storage tank explosions, and processing unit failures that result in multiple casualties and widespread property damage.
4. Power Plant Explosions
Explosions at electrical generating facilities, including coal, natural gas, and nuclear plants, caused by boiler failures, steam explosions, or equipment malfunctions that endanger workers and surrounding areas.
5. Manufacturing Plant Explosions
Industrial accidents at factories and manufacturing facilities involving combustible materials, dust explosions, equipment failures, or improper storage of hazardous materials that cause workplace injuries and community evacuations.

The statute of limitations varies by state and type of claim, typically ranging from 1-3 years from the date of the explosion or discovery of injuries. However, plant explosion cases often involve complex regulatory and environmental issues that may extend filing deadlines. It's crucial to contact an attorney immediately to protect your rights.
Multiple parties may be responsible including the plant owner/operator, equipment manufacturers, maintenance contractors, safety consultants, government inspectors who failed in their duties, and companies that supplied defective materials or chemicals. We investigate all potential defendants to maximize your recovery.
Damages may include medical expenses, lost wages, pain and suffering, property damage, evacuation costs, environmental cleanup, diminished property values, and punitive damages. In wrongful death cases, families can recover funeral expenses, loss of financial support, and loss of companionship.
We work with industrial safety experts to analyze the explosion cause, review safety protocols, examine maintenance records, investigate regulatory violations, and document how the company failed to meet industry safety standards. OSHA citations and regulatory violations often provide strong evidence of negligence.
Plant explosions often result in class action lawsuits or mass tort litigation when multiple victims are affected. We have experience handling both individual cases and complex multi-plaintiff litigation to ensure all victims receive fair compensation for their injuries and losses.
Yes, wrongful death lawsuits can be filed when plant explosions result in fatalities. These cases can recover damages for funeral expenses, lost future earnings, loss of companionship, and the pain and suffering of surviving family members.
